THIS SECOND AMENDMENT to Loan and Security Agreement (this “Amendment”) is entered into this 25th day of August, 2011 by and between Silicon Valley Bank (“Bank”) and FATE THERAPEUTICS, INC., a Delaware corporation (“Borrower”) whose address is 3535 General Atomics Court, Suite 200, San Diego, CA 92121.

RECITALS

A. Bank and Borrower have entered into that certain Loan and Security Agreement dated as of January 5, 2009, as amended by that certain Amendment No. 1 to Loan and Security Agreement dated as of May 4, 2010 (as the same may from time to time be further amended, modified, supplemented or restated, the “Loan Agreement”).

B. Bank has extended credit to Borrower for the purposes permitted in the Loan Agreement.

C. Borrower has requested that Bank amend the Loan Agreement to (i) refinance Borrower’s existing Obligations to Bank with a new Term Loan and (ii) make certain other revisions to the Loan Agreement as more fully set forth herein.

D. Bank has agreed to so amend certain provisions of the Loan Agreement, but only to the extent, in accordance with the terms, subject to the conditions and in reliance upon the representations and warranties set forth below.

AGREEMENT

NOW, THEREFORE, in consideration of the foregoing recitals and other good and valuable consideration, the receipt and adequacy of which is hereby acknowledged, and intending to be legally bound, the parties hereto agree as follows:

1. Definitions. Capitalized terms used but not defined in this Amendment shall have the meanings given to them in the Loan Agreement.

2. Amendments to Loan Agreement.

2.1 Borrower shall deliver to Bank a landlord waiver for Borrower’s location at 3535 General Atomics Court, Suite 200, San Diego, CA 92121, in form and substance satisfactory to Bank by no later than September 24, 2011.

2.2 Section 2.1.1 (Term Loan). Section 2.1.1 of the Loan Agreement is amended in its entirety to read as follows:

(a) Availability. Subject to the terms and conditions of this Agreement, on the Second Amendment Date, or as soon thereafter as is practical, Bank shall make a Term Advance to Borrower in the aggregate principal amount of $2,000,000, which shall be used (i) to refinance all Indebtedness owing from Borrower to Bank as of the Second Amendment Date and (ii) for general working capital (the “Tranche A Term Advance”). In addition, within ten (10) Business Days of Borrower providing Bank satisfactory evidence of the commencement of Borrower’s next clinical trial of the therapeutic program known by and between Bank and Borrower as “FT1050”, Bank shall make an additional Term Advance to Borrower in the aggregate principal amount of $2,000,000 (the “Tranche B Term Advance”, and together with the Tranche A Term Advance, the “Term Advances”); provided, however, that the commencement of


such clinical trial (y) has been approved by Borrower’s Board of Directors and (z) occurs prior to December 31, 2011, each as confirmed by due diligence calls between Bank and Borrower’s management and/or Board of Directors. The Term Advances may not exceed the Term Loan Amount.

(b) Interest Payments. Commencing on the first Payment Date of the month following the month in which the Funding Date of each Term Advance occurs, Borrower shall make monthly payments of interest in connection with each Term Advance at the rate set forth in Section 2.2(a).

(c) Repayment. Commencing on the twelfth (12th) month following the Funding Date of each Term Advance, and continuing on the Payment Date of each month thereafter, Borrower shall repay each Term Advance in (i) twenty-four (24) equal installments of principal, plus (ii) monthly payments of accrued interest at the rate set forth in Section 2.2(a) (each, a “Term Loan Payment”). For each Term Advance, Borrower’s final Term Loan Payment, due on the Term Loan Maturity Date of such Term Advance, shall include (y) all outstanding principal and accrued and unpaid interest under such Term Advance and (z) an additional final payment equal to 5.00% of such Term Advance (the “Final Payment”). After repayment, each Term Advance may not be re-borrowed.

(d) Mandatory Prepayment. If a Term Advance is accelerated following the occurrence and during the continuance of an Event of Default, or if Borrower voluntarily prepays any Term Advance for any reason on or before the date eighteen (18) months after the Second Amendment Date, Borrower shall immediately pay to Bank, in addition to any other sums owing, a termination fee equal to 2.50% of the applicable Term Advance (the “Term Loan Termination Fee”). Such Term Loan Termination Fee shall bear interest until paid at a rate equal to the highest rate applicable to the Obligations. Notwithstanding the foregoing, if Borrower prepays any Term Advance at any time with a new credit facility from Bank, the Term Loan Termination Fee shall not be applied to such Term Advance.

(e) Permitted Prepayment of Term Advances. So long as no Event of Default has occurred and is continuing, Borrower shall have the option to prepay all, but not less than all, of the Term Advances advanced by Bank under this Agreement, provided Borrower (i) delivers written notice to Bank of its election to prepay such Term Advances at least five (5) days prior to such prepayment, and (ii) pays on the date of such prepayment (A) all outstanding principal plus accrued and unpaid interest, (B) the Final Payment, (C) the Term Loan Termination Fee, if applicable, and (D) all other sums, if any, that shall have become due and payable, including interest at the Default Rate with respect to any past due amounts thereon.

2.3 Section 2.2 (Payment of Interest on the Credit Extensions). Section 2.2(a) of the Loan Agreement is amended in its entirety and replaced with the following:

(a) Interest Rate. Subject to Section 2.2(b), the principal amount of each Term Advance outstanding under the Term Loan shall accrue interest at a fixed per annum rate equal to the greater of (i) three and three quarters of one percent (3.75%) above the Prime Rate or (ii) seven percent (7.0%), which rate shall be fixed for each Term Advance as of the Funding Date of such Term Advance, and which interest shall be payable in arrears.

2.5 Section 13 (Definitions). The following terms and their respective definitions set forth in Section 13.1 are either added or amended in their entirety and replaced with the following:

Fate UK” is Fate Therapeutics Ltd., a private limited company formed under the laws of England and Wales, and a Subsidiary of Borrower.

Loan Documents” are, collectively, this Agreement, the Warrant, the Second Warrant, the Perfection Certificate, any subordination agreements, any note, or notes or guaranties executed by Borrower or any Guarantor, and any other present or future agreement between Borrower any Guarantor and/or for the benefit of Bank in connection with this Agreement, all as amended, restated, or otherwise modified.

Obligations” are Borrower’s obligation to pay when due any debts, principal, interest, Bank Expenses and other amounts Borrower owes Bank now or later, whether under this Agreement, the Loan Documents, or otherwise, including, without limitation, all obligations relating to letters of credit (including reimbursement obligations for drawn and undrawn letters of credit), the Term Loan Termination Fee, the Final Payment, cash management services, and foreign exchange contracts, if any, and including interest accruing after Insolvency Proceedings begin and debts, liabilities, or obligations of Borrower assigned to Bank, and the performance of Borrower’s duties under the Loan Documents.

Prime Rate” is the U.S. Prime Rate published from time to time in the Western Edition of The Wall Street Journal, even if it is not Bank’s lowest rate.

Second Amendment Date” is August 25, 2011.

Second Warrant” is that certain Warrant to Purchase Stock dated as of the Second Amendment Date executed by Borrower in favor of Bank.

Term Loan Amount” is an amount up to Four Million Dollars ($4,000,000).

Term Loan Maturity Date” is (a) August 25, 2014 in the case of the Tranche A Term Advance and (b) the date thirty-six (36) months after the date such Term Advance is extended by Bank, in the case of the Tranche B Term Advance.
